How To Reconnect Your Google Drive

Chad Brown
2 min read

First Ensure the File is still on Google Drive

Orangedox links to your Google Drive to ensure you’re always sharing the latest copy of your files. Make sure that you haven’t removed the Google Drive file, if so you’ll need to re-create a new Orangedox link or add the file back into your Google Drive shared folder, if you’ve shared a folder on Orangedox.

Reconnect your Google Drive to Orangedox

In some cases your Google Drive account may become disconnected from Orangedox. You can reconnect your Google Drive account with Orangedox by completing the following steps

Logout of Orangedox

Navigate to the Orangedox app https://app.orangedox.com . Then in the upper right-hand corner of the screen click on your name and in the dropdown menu select “Logout” or simply click here



Remove the Orangedox app from your Google Drive

The next step is to remove the Orangedox app from your Google Drive account, this will allow us to reconnect to your Google Drive the next time you login.  

Follow these steps in this article to remove Orangedox from your Google Drive account

https://www.orangedox.com/blog/resources/how-to-remove-a-google-drive-app

Re-login to Orangedox

Simply re-login to the Orangedox app https://app.orangedox.com . This should establish a new connection to your Google Drive account. Then check your existing shared files, they should now be working correctly.
